UpSync גרסה 0.7 שוחרר

הגרסה החדשה כבר כאן! כמו תמיד, מומלץ לשדרג בהקדם האפשרי. להלן השינויים העיקריים:

  • הרשאות מנהל מערכת נדרשות עוד כדי להפעיל את היישום מתיקיית Program Files, הגדרות היישום ויומני מאוחסנים כעת בנתוני התוכנית תיקיות Windows.
  • היישום נבדק עם וצריכים עכשיו עובד בסדר עם UAC תחת Windows Vista ו-Windows 7.
  • יומני סיכום נוספו בסוף רישום לדווח על סכומים לספור על פעולות שונות.
  • תוקן באג ב פונקציונליות תיקיות syncing חדשה ריקה שגרמה לופ שאינו נגמר כאשר הבסיס של התיקייה או היה ריק.
  • הוסיף "מסנן קובץ" נכס לתיקיות הממופים לאפשר את השימוש בתווים כלליים (*. Txt) כדי להגביל את הקבצים כדי לסנכרן (כפי שהתבקש על ידי ג'ייסון שאול).

כל שעליך לעשות הוא להפעיל את תוכנית ההתקנה כדי לשדרג לגרסה העדכנית ביותר.

הורד UpSync 0.7 הגדרת
הורד UpSync 0.7 קוד המקור (Visual Studio 2008 חובה)

זכור לחלוק מחשבות והצעות!

15 Comments פורסם ב C # , תוכנה , טכנולוגיה , UpSync , Visual Studio 2008 | 15 תגובות

UpSync גרסה 0.6 שוחרר

יש לי גרסה חדשה של UpSync להוציא היום! אם אתה באופן קבוע באמצעות היישום, מומלץ בחום לשדרג בגלל היציבות של תהליך סנכרון שופר מאוד. הנה רשימה קצרה של חלק מהשינויים היותר מעניינים:

  • שגיאה שיפור משמעותי בטיפול
  • מחק מבקש כעת מוצגת בבת אחת (במקום לאורך כל התהליך)
  • החדש "להפסיק להציג ו עושה את זה בשביל X קבצים שנותרו" תכונה נוספה
  • הקוד הוא עכשיו StyleCop תואם (כמו גם קוד ניתוח תואם)
  • תיקיות ריקות מסונכרנות כעת כראוי על פי תאריך היצירה שלהם

אתה יכול פשוט להפעיל את ההתקנה החדשה וזה אוטומטית לשדרג את הגרסה הישנה מה שהתקנת.

הורד UpSync 0.6 הגדרת
הורד UpSync 0.6 קוד המקור (Visual Studio 2008 חובה)

יש לזכור, על מנת להגיב ולשתף את המחשבות שלך על היישום! :)

2 Comments פורסם ב C # , תוכנה , טכנולוגיה , UpSync , Visual Studio 2008 | 2 תגובות

מרכוז תיבת הודעה על החלון הפעיל ב-C #

אחד אזהרות מעצבנים של שימוש מובנה בתיבה. הודעה NET היא שהיא לא מספקת פונקציונליות תיבת הודעה על מרכז החלון הפעיל כרגע. באופן מוזר, גם כאשר אתה מציין את חלון האב באמצעות הגירסה עמוס התקין של שיטת השידור (), החלון עדיין מתעקש שבמרכזו עצמו על שולחן העבודה, במקום על החלון הפעיל. זה מעצבן ומבלבל למשתמש הקצה, כי זה שובר את היכולת להניח בצד את "המסך הנדל"ן" במיוחד עבור יישום. למרבה המזל, יש דרך לתקן את זה, אם כי אין לערב את Win32 API.

המשך קריאה ...

19 Comments פורסם ב C # , טכנולוגיה , Visual Studio 2008 | 19 תגובות

6 אנאלי-retentive דרכים לשיפור קוד C שלך #

שום דבר לא מציק לי יותר מאשר צריך לחפור באמצעות קוד זבל. עבודה בחברת ייעוץ תוכנה, ראיתי שורה ארוכה כל כך. ואני כבר השליך על המחשב שלי מספיק לעקוב אחר כתוצאה לתת לו יפה, חום, ירוק גוון. קוד רע הורס חומרה. והנשמות.

הרמז היחיד הגדול ביותר, כי מפתח אחד אין מושג מה הם עושים או שפשוט לא אכפת הקוד שלהם הוא חוסר העקביות. לכולנו יש העדפות שונות וסגנונות קידוד, אבל כאשר היזם אינו יכול לבחור בגישה מסוימת לקחת הם באים בתור חובב מאוד, ולא בכדי. קוד עולה בקנה אחד קשה לקרוא, קשה ובכך לשנות בעתיד.

רוב (או אפילו את כולה) של הרשימה הבאה סובבת סביב כתיבת מנוסח באופן עקבי בעקביות ביצוע קוד C #. חלק גדול של רשימה זו היא אמנם retentive אנאלי, אבל כל זה הוא מתיימר לשפר את האיכות ואת הקריאות של הקוד שלך.

המשך קריאה ...

4 Comments פורסם ב C # , טכנולוגיה , Visual Studio 2008 | 4 תגובות

UpSync גרסה 0.5 שוחרר

להלן הורדות עבור ההתקנה ואת מקורות לשחרור הרשמי הראשון של UpSync, גרסה 0.5. כפי שציינתי בפוסט הקודם שלי, זה עובד כמו שצריך ב-Windows XP ו-Vista, כמו גם Windows 7. לתיאור הבקשה, ועוד כמה צילומי מסך, ראה בהודעה הקודמת.

אם אתה משתמש בו, תן לי לדעת! אני מעוניין בכל סוג של משוב.

הורד UpSync 0.5 הגדרת
הורד UpSync 0.5 קוד המקור (Visual Studio 2008 חובה)

4 Comments פורסם ב C # , תוכנה , טכנולוגיה , UpSync , Visual Studio 2008 | 4 תגובות

יישום חדש - UpSync

לא מזמן התחלתי לעבוד על יישום חדש בשם UpSync. לפי מה אתה יכול לספר בטח כבר מהשם, היישום נועד לסנכרן קבצים בין התיקיות על מחשבים שונים. זה אמור להיות קל לשימוש, אלא גם את ומלוכלך מספיק כדי לענות על הצרכים של מנהל המערכת טיפוסי.

אני פתוח המקור הפרויקט, ותהיה לי ההתקנה את קוד המקור של גרסה 0.5 עד זמן קצר מאוד. זה עובד כמו שצריך ב-Windows XP, Vista, ואפילו של מיקרוסופט חדשה, שלא פורסמה Windows 7 (צילומי מסך הם מ-Windows 7). זה כתוב ב-C #, האהוב עלי של שפות. נטו, באמצעות Visual Studio 2008.

הנה כמה מן התכונות העיקריות שכבר יושמו:

  • כל מספר של תיקיות ניתן לסנכרן עם הגדרות נפרדות עבור כל תיקייה.
  • סנכרן בכיוון אחד, בכיוון השני, או בשני הכיוונים ללא כל אינטראקציה הצורך.
  • הגדרות ספציפיות לטיפול בקבצים שנמחקו לאפשר לכל המצבים האפשריים.
  • סינכרון המנוע משתמש התאריכים והשעות של קבצים על מנת להבטיח את הגירסה העדכנית ביותר של קבצים משוכפלים.
  • קבצים חדשים בתיקייה או מטופלות באופן אוטומטי בצורה נכונה להעתיק אל התיקייה השנייה.
  • תהליך הסינכרון יכול להיות אוטומטי לחלוטין או להפעיל באופן ידני.
  • סינכרון מנוע מתחבר כל מבצע בפירוט מלא ולכן אף פעם אין שום בלבול לגבי מה קבצים השתנו.
4 Comments פורסם ב C # , תוכנה , טכנולוגיה , UpSync , Visual Studio 2008 | 4 תגובות